§ 27-81-115. Emergency service patrol - establishment - rules

CO Rev Stat ยง 27-81-115 (2016) What's This?

(1) The unit and cities, counties, city and counties, and regional service authorities may establish emergency service patrols. A patrol consists of persons trained to give assistance in the streets and in other public places to persons who are intoxicated or incapacitated by alcohol. Members of an emergency service patrol shall be capable of providing first aid in emergency situations and shall be authorized to transport a person intoxicated or incapacitated by alcohol to his or her home and to and from treatment facilities.

(2) The director shall adopt rules for the establishment, training, and conduct of emergency service patrols.
